[PSS 2017][Bug] Synchronized project extensions

Post by Bosparan »

PSS Version: 2017 5.4.143 x64
OS Version: Windows 10 x64 Creators Update
WMF Version: 5.1

Impact: Minor

Symptom:
There is a default list of extensions that are synchronized. This list contains a typo: "*.psxml" instead of "*.ps1xml".
It also should list ".txt" files by default (for concept help files).

Reproducibility:
- Create a module project
- Add a .ps1xml file in the folder (but not the project!)
- Set it to synchronized
- Watch the ps1xml not appearing
